Monocrystalline Solar Panels



When taking into consideration photovoltaic panels, you might encounter monocrystalline solar panels. These panels are recognized for their high performance rates due to their building from a solitary constant crystal framework. This design allows monocrystalline panels to perform better in reduced light problems compared to various other sorts of photovoltaic panels. In addition, their sleek black look makes them a prominent choice for household setups, assimilating seamlessly with most rooftops.

Polycrystalline Solar Panels



Polycrystalline solar panels, additionally known as multicrystalline photovoltaic panels, provide an alternate option to monocrystalline panels. These panels are made from silicon crystals that are melted with each other, developing a less consistent look contrasted to monocrystalline panels.

Among the key advantages of polycrystalline panels is their reduced manufacturing expense, making them an extra economical choice for property owners aiming to invest in solar power.

Thin-Film Solar Panels



Carrying on to Thin-Film Solar Panels, these panels offer a distinct choice to typical silicon-based alternatives like polycrystalline panels. However, it's vital to note that thin-film panels generally have lower efficiency rates compared to crystalline silicon panels. This suggests you might require even more area to produce the same amount of electrical power.

On the silver lining, thin-film panels carry out better in low-light conditions and have a reduced temperature coefficient, implying they can create even more power on hot days.
